Side by side double prams have two seats adjacent to each other, so that your children can view each other and have fun while on a walk. However, they are typically wider than single prams and therefore may not fit through some doorways or be difficult to maneuver on busy footpaths or in shopping centres. They are also generally bulkier when folded.

Tandem (in-line) double prams are a bit more maneuverable, but they aren't as narrow as single prams. They are more difficult to fold as the seat is often farther away from the handle. Additionally, they might require more parts once you are ready to use them. They are also more expensive than a side-by-side double pram.

Many first-time parents opt for an convertible double pram to ensure their purchase is secure for the future and can use it in double or single mode based on your family's needs. However, they're usually quite wide and bulky when folded. They might not be suitable for your child as they grow out of their pram seat. Be careful to do some thorough research prior to purchasing.

A common choice is a side-byside double pram that has two fixed seats for children of similar age. They are typically more compact than tandem or in-line double prams, making it easier to navigate through doors, on busy footpaths and in shops. You can use them with car seats or carrycots if you prefer.
